Distance from Hay Lakes to Wadena

The straight-line distance between Hay Lakes and Wadena is 640.1 km. The estimated road distance by car is around 723 km, with an indicative drive time of 8 h 2 min.

Straight-line distance 640.1 km
Estimated road distance ~723 km
Indicative drive time 8 h 2 min
Note: values are approximate estimates. Road distance is calculated by multiplying the straight-line distance by a road-deviation factor (1.13–1.30 based on length). Drive time assumes ~90 km/h average. Real traffic, tolls, and conditions can vary significantly. Use the live planner for current data.

Driving directions from Hay Lakes to Wadena

Real distance: 699.5 km  ·  Estimated time: 8 h 35 min

🗓 Calculated on June 4, 2026
  1. Drive east on Highway 617/617. Continue on 617. 27.9 km
  2. Turn right onto Range Road 190/834. 19.4 km
  3. Turn left onto 26. 71.0 km
  4. Turn right onto Poundmaker Trail/14. 231.1 km
  5. Turn left onto Highway 4/40/4/40. Continue on 4/40. 3.4 km
  6. Keep right to take 16 East toward Saskatoon/Prince Albert. 128.8 km
  7. Turn left onto 71 Street West. 5.5 km
  8. Turn right onto Wanuskewin Road. 530 m
  9. Turn left onto Marquis Drive. 11.4 km
  10. Turn left to take the 5 East ramp toward College Drive East. 54.1 km
  11. Turn left onto Veterans Memorial Highway/2/5. 5.5 km
  12. Turn right onto Highway 5/5. Continue on 5. 85.7 km
